    Activity of a radioactive element decreased to one third of original activity \[{{R}_{0}}\] in 9 yr. After further 9 yr, its activity will be

    A)  \[{{R}_{0}}\]                                     

    B)  \[\frac{2}{3}{{R}_{0}}\]

    C)  \[\frac{{{R}_{0}}}{9}\]                                  

    D)  \[\frac{{{R}_{0}}}{6}\]

    Correct Answer: C

    Solution :

                    Activity, \[R={{R}_{0}}{{e}^{-\lambda t}}\] \[\frac{{{R}_{0}}}{3}={{R}_{0}}{{e}^{-\lambda \times 9}}\] \[\Rightarrow \]               \[{{e}^{-9\lambda }}=\frac{1}{3}\] After further 9 yr \[R=R{{e}^{-\lambda t}}=\frac{{{R}_{0}}}{3}\times {{e}^{-\lambda \times 9}}\] From Eqs. (i) and (ii), we have \[R=\frac{{{R}_{0}}}{9}\]
